Redmi Pad with a 7800mAh battery appeared on FCC

As we all know how successful Mi Pad 5 and Xiaomi are now preparing for their new Pad series called Xiaomi Pad 6. But along with Xiaomi, Xiaomi’s sub-brand Redmi also does not want to be left behind in this race. Just a few days ago there was a report that Redmi is going to launch its first entry-level tablet, some pictures were also revealed of Redmi Pad but today according to a new report Redmi Pad has been listed in FCC.

According to the latest news from the well-known tipster Digital Chat Station, the first Redmi Pad has already entered the FCC. The information shows that the device will have a built-in 7800mAh battery, the MIUI 13 system will be pre-installed at the factory, only support WiFi networks, and no 4G/5G version.

At this time, only listing details appear and not a single piece of information announced yet. Previously, a report stated that the device will be equipped with an LCD screen of about 10.61 inches.

According to previous news, Xiaomi has obtained an a-Si LCD screen with a size of 10.61″± and a resolution of 2000*1200P. From the perspective of parameters, it is an entry-level specification, and there is a high probability that it is this Redmi Pad.
